The Compliance Cost Burden Squeezing Fintech Margins
Financial services firms spend more on compliance than nearly any other industry vertical. In 2026, regulatory mandates around KYC, AML, GDPR, and emerging AI governance frameworks compound faster than internal teams absorb. The result: a growing cost burden eating directly into operating margins at a time when fintechs race to reach profitability.
The global BPO market was valued at $328 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ach $695 billion by 2033 at a 9.9% CAGR (Grand View Research). Financial services outsourcing accounts for 21.4% of that market. CFOs who resisted outsourcing compliance are reconsidering: AI-enabled BPO partners now deliver accuracy, speed, and auditability that in-house teams cannot match at scale.
Accelerating this shift is the emergence of agentic AI inside BPO operations. Rather than rule-based automation, agentic systems make multi-step decisions, route cases, flag anomalies, and complete documentation end-to-end, dramatically reducing labor per compliance event.
KYC and AML: Where AI BPO Delivers the Fastest ROI
Know Your Customer (KYC) and Anti-Money Laundering (AML) processes represent the most immediate opportunity for AI-enabled outsourcing in fintech. Getting these wrong means enormous fines and churn from friction-heavy onboarding. Getting them right, manually, is equally punishing on cost.
Results from firms deploying AI-powered BPO for KYC and AML:
- Onboarding compressed from 5-15 business days to 10-20 minutes for standard-risk profiles
- Up to 70% reduction in KYC costs through automation and intelligent document processing
- 90% reduction in false positives, cutting analyst hours wasted on non-events
- 40-60% lower per-case processing cost in organizations using agentic compliance pipelines
- 32% overall compliance cost reduction for institutions running orchestrated AI approaches
U.S. financial firms deployed over 1,200 regulatory AI models in 2024, concentrated in AML, KYC, fraud detection, and transaction screening. Over 40% of banks initiated AI-driven compliance automation pilots during onboarding that same year (RegTech Analyst). The runway from pilot to production is shrinking fast.
The Agentic AML Pipeline in Practice
In a modern AI BPO deployment, a suspicious transaction is not handed to a queue of analysts. An agentic AI system pulls the customer record, cross-references watchlists, scores risk against transaction history, drafts the Suspicious Activity Report, and routes it for human review only when genuinely ambiguous. BPO teams in Manila and Hyderabad handle final-mile judgment, but with AI doing the heavy lifting, certified compliance agents clear three to five times more cases per shift.
Fraud Detection and AP Automation: The Next Fintech BPO Wave
KYC and AML were the first compliance functions to migrate to AI BPO. In 2026, two adjacent categories are following rapidly: fraud detection operations and accounts payable automation.
Fintech fraud detection has historically required a large, always-on ops team to monitor transaction streams, investigate alerts, and coordinate with law enforcement. AI BPO restructures this model. Leading BPO partners have established specialized fraud AI academies, certifying agents in fraud analytics, AML/CFT frameworks, and AI-assisted investigation tools. At roughly $14 per hour for certified fraud specialists versus $80-120 per hour for in-house equivalents in major U.S. cities, the cost arbitrage is substantial. AI-trained BPO teams also catch more fraud faster.
On the accounts payable side, the 2026 trend is touchless invoice processing: AI captures invoice data, matches against purchase orders, flags exceptions, and routes approvals with no human touchpoints on standard transactions. Organizations implementing AI-enabled AP BPO have reported a 57% jump in automation rates across outsourced financial operations. Per-invoice cost falls while early payment discount capture improves because cycle times drop from weeks to hours.
CX at Scale: How AI BPO Transforms Fintech Customer Experience
Compliance and back-office automation get the headlines, but the customer experience layer is equally consequential for fintech margins. Churn is expensive. Disputed transactions, confusing statements, and slow dispute resolution are the leading causes of account abandonment in digital banking and payments.
AI-enabled BPO is transforming fintech CX across three dimensions:
- Intelligent triage: AI agents handle Tier-1 queries including balance inquiries, transaction lookups, and card block requests autonomously, with human BPO agents reserved for escalations requiring judgment or empathy
- Dispute automation: AI systems retrieve transaction records, apply chargeback rules, and draft resolution letters, compressing dispute cycles from 10 or more days to under 48 hours
- Proactive retention: Predictive models flag customers at churn risk before they cancel, triggering retention workflows that BPO agents execute with AI-drafted scripts and contextual data
Fintechs deploying AI-enabled BPO for customer support report satisfaction increases up to 70% alongside cost reduction, evidence that efficiency and experience quality are no longer in tension. Agentic AI handling post-call work autonomously eliminates up to 80% of after-call documentation burden within six months of deployment.

How to Choose the Right Fintech BPO Partner in 2026
Not every BPO is equipped for fintech work. Regulatory exposure, data sensitivity, and integration complexity demand partners with demonstrated financial services credentials. CFOs and COOs should pressure-test on four dimensions:
- Regulatory certifications: SOC 2 Type II, ISO 27001, PCI-DSS for payments, and GLBA for U.S. financial data are table stakes. Verify certificates directly, not just vendor claims.
- AI stack transparency: Know which AI models handle which decisions, what the human review thresholds are, and how the audit trail is generated. Regulatory examiners will ask these questions.
- Integration depth: The best fintech BPOs operate inside your core banking, CRM, and payments systems. API-first integration is non-negotiable for real-time fraud and compliance workflows.
- Vertical track record: A BPO with deep insurance or HR experience is not automatically qualified for fintech. Require case studies in your product category: payments, lending, neobanking, or wealth management.
